The Plight of Underperforming Power Lithium – Ion Batteries

Inadequate Energy Density

  1. Limited Range in Electric Vehicles
For electric vehicles (EVs), underperforming power lithium – ion batteries with low energy density translate to a limited driving range. This is a major deterrent for potential EV buyers, as the fear of running out of power during a trip, known as “range anxiety,” is a significant concern. For instance, a commuter relying on an electric car with a low – energy – density battery may have to constantly plan their routes around charging stations, which can be inconvenient and time – consuming.
  1. Insufficient Power for Industrial Applications
In industrial applications, such as electric forklifts or construction equipment, low – energy – density batteries mean that the machinery can’t operate for extended periods without frequent recharging. This leads to decreased productivity, as workers have to halt operations to recharge the batteries, causing delays in projects and increased operational costs.

Short Cycle Life

  1. Frequent Replacements
Power lithium – ion batteries with a short cycle life require frequent replacements. This not only adds to the overall cost but also creates environmental waste. For example, in a large – scale energy storage system for a solar power plant, if the batteries have a short cycle life, the plant operators will have to replace them every few years, incurring high replacement costs and disposal challenges.
  1. Unreliable Performance Over Time
As the battery goes through more charge – discharge cycles, its performance degrades rapidly in underperforming batteries. This results in a loss of capacity and power output, making the battery less reliable for long – term use. In a grid – scale energy storage system, a battery with a deteriorating performance can disrupt the stability of the power grid, leading to power outages or voltage fluctuations.

Subpar Safety and Durability

  1. Safety Risks
Some underperforming power lithium – ion batteries pose safety risks, such as the potential for thermal runaway or over – heating. In EVs, this can lead to battery fires, endangering the lives of passengers and causing significant damage to the vehicle. In portable power tools, a battery that over – heats can cause burns or even explosions, putting users at risk.
  1. Lack of Durability
These batteries may also lack durability, unable to withstand harsh operating conditions. In extreme temperatures, high humidity, or high – vibration environments, underperforming batteries may experience reduced performance or even fail completely. For example, in mining operations where equipment is exposed to dust, moisture, and vibrations, a non – durable battery will quickly degrade, leading to equipment failures.
